We visited the resort in April 2010 (1st ever ski trip) and then again for Christmas 2010. We're planning a 3rd trip this coming April. It is a great beginner resort with decent groomed slopes, no nasty surprises or random piste classifications (i'm looking at you Val d'Isere!), lots of ski in-ski out, excellent equipment hire and generally very quiet (certainly when compared to the Alps).
Now that we have been to the Alps and skied Espace Killy and Paradiski, we can see the limitations of a resort like Hemsedal. It's not large and it would be a little tame for good intermediates/advanced skiers. We'll probably concentrate on the Alps from next season, particularly as we are seeking greater piste mileage and variety.
The snow in April 2010 was excellent and the whole resort held up well. We struggled a bit in December 2010 as the snowfall was poor at the beginning of the season. It was very cold though.
Apres ski is quite limited but the food in the restaurants is good (although fairly expensive).
